Which one of the following statements concerning muscle diseases is incorrect?
a. Muscle contractile activity occurring independent of normal voluntary excitation-contraction coupling is termed a contracture.
b. Heritable human diseases typically have great genetic diversity (many causative mutations), while heritable animal mutations have far less genetic diversity due to a single common founder.
c. Charcot Marie Tooth disease is a group of related genetic disorders caused by progressive demyelination of peripheral nerves and disturbances in nerve conduction.
d. Myasthenia gravis results from an immune-mediated loss of functional acetylcholine receptors at the neuromuscular junction that in turn impairs activation of muscle contraction.
e. Mutations in the RYR2 gene have been found to be associated with diseases affecting cardiac muscle contractility.
Explanation / Answer
the answer is E , because Mutations in the RYR2 gene are associated with catecholaminergic polymorphic ventricular tachycardia, stress-induced polymorphic ventricular tachycardia, and arrhythmogenic right ventricular dysplasia
